This charming oil painting captures the bustling energy of Montmartre’s famed Moulin Rouge, a Parisian landmark immortalized by countless artists. Painted by British-American artist Caroline Burnett, the composition evokes the golden age of Parisian street life with textured brushwork and vibrant, romantic tones. The scene, rendered in the tradition of Edouard Cortès–style street scenes, presents elegantly dressed figures walking along a lively boulevard beneath the crimson sails of the Moulin Rouge. Set in a beautifully layered giltwood frame with linen liner and gold filet, the piece is both evocative and decorative, a perfect marriage of fine art and Parisian nostalgia.

Key Features:

 • Origin: France
 • Artist: Caroline Burnett (1877–1950)
 • Medium: Oil on canvas
 • Date: Mid-20th century
 • Subject: Montmartre – Moulin Rouge
 • Style: Impressionist street scene, Cortès-inspired
 • Frame: Giltwood with linen liner and gold filet
 • Condition: Very good vintage condition with age-appropriate wear to the frame
